以2-氰基吡嗪为原料合成2-氨甲基吡嗪的一般步骤如下:参照文献(JP A 2001-894594)所述方法,具体操作如下。原料2-氰基吡啶购自Sigma-Aldrich Co.LLC。将1.05g(10mmol)的2-氰基吡啶和100mg的60wt% Ni/SiO2催化剂置于20mL甲苯中,装入高压釜(型号5U5316)内,随后用氩气置换釜内空气。在氢气氛围下加压至50atm,于140℃反应温度下搅拌反应4小时。反应完成后,将反应液过滤除去催化剂,滤液经浓缩处理,定量得到目标产物2-氨甲基吡啶(2-AMPZ)。产物经1H-NMR(399.78MHz, CDCl3)表征:δ 8.60-8.45(m, 3H), 4.07(s, 2H), 1.79(br, 2H)。
